Contemporary Garden Decor: Large Outdoor Water Fountains and their Beginnings

Contemporary Garden Decor: Large Outdoor Water Fountains Beginnings 7643304132560452.jpg Contemporary Garden Decor: Large Outdoor Water Fountains and their Beginnings A water fountain is an architectural piece that pours water into a basin or jets it high into the air in order to supply drinking water, as well as for decorative purposes.

From the onset, outdoor fountains were simply meant to serve as functional elements. Water fountains were connected to a spring or aqueduct to supply potable water as well as bathing water for cities, townships and villages. Used until the 19th century, in order for fountains to flow or shoot up into the air, their origin of water such as reservoirs or aqueducts, had to be higher than the water fountain in order to benefit from the power of gravity. Designers thought of fountains as amazing additions to a living space, however, the fountains also served to supply clean water and honor the designer responsible for creating it. Animals or heroes made of bronze or stone masks were often used by Romans to decorate their fountains. During the Middle Ages, Muslim and Moorish garden designers included fountains in their designs to mimic the gardens of paradise. King Louis XIV of France wanted to illustrate his superiority over nature by including fountains in the Gardens of Versailles. Seventeen and 18 century Popes sought to extol their positions by including decorative baroque-style fountains at the point where restored Roman aqueducts arrived into the city.

Since indoor plumbing became the norm of the day for fresh, drinking water, by the end of the 19th century urban fountains were no longer needed for this purpose and they became purely ornamental. Gravity was replaced by mechanical pumps in order to permit fountains to bring in clean water and allow for amazing water displays.

Nowadays, fountains adorn public areas and are used to pay tribute to individuals or events and fill recreational and entertainment needs.

Free Water Fountains in and Around Berkley, California

Free Water Fountains in and Around Berkley, California The first example of a soda tax in the USA came in February 2014, when it was passed by the city of Berkley, California. The tax is thought to decrease sugary drink intake and augment the consumption of healthier drinks, such as water from fountains. Research was conducted to ensure that citizens of all races and economic classes had access to clean, operating drinking fountains. The research utilized a GPS app to collect data on present water fountains in the city. Investigators then used US Census data to find out more about the economic and racial factors that influenced the city. Evaluations were made amongst the location and demographic data, uncovering whether class differences affected access to clean, working water fountains. Each water fountain and the demographics of its neighboring area were analyzed to reveal whether the location of the fountains or their standard of maintenance exhibited any correlation to income, race, or other points. Some of the water fountains were dirty or blocked, despite the fact that a lot of fountains worked.
